Bloom Size: Over 2"

Form: WL - Waterlily

Color: LB WHI/PK/DP

Height Varies: 4 feet

Hybridizer: Don and Molly Kelly

Year Introduced: 2004

ADS Classification: 7310

Notes: Kelgai Ann is relatively small in stature and doesn't need as much support or staking as other varieties.  For all the florists and cut flower growers, her stems are thin, but straight. Her flowers are delicate. The vase life is typically several days at the most. In my opinion, she does not make for a great cut flower, but she is absolutely stunning as a focal plant in the garden. We've seen photos of Kelgai Ann with a lot of pink on the petals, but for us, she blooms mostly a cream color with a few subtle hints of pink on the outer petals. As the weather cools, she puts out more pink streaks on her petals. We did our best to photograph what she looks like when she blooms here in zone 8B. Kelgai Ann is one-of-a-kind and best enjoyed as a garden flower.

Dahlia care: Wait until all danger of frost is past before planting. Dahlias should not be planted outdoors until ground temperature reaches 55-60 degrees. Hold off planting if the forecast is predicting rain. Overwatering newly planted tubers may lead to rot.

Dahlias thrive in rich, well-drained soil. Use slug and snail bait at planting, don't wait until the sprout appears.

Dahlias should be planted in full sun in a location that receives a minimum of 6-8 hours of sun.

Most dahlias grow quite tall and require support, similar to tomato plants.
